Inhaltsangabe

Part 1: Observatory Persuasion.- Chapter 1: Introduction to Multicriteria Decision Making in Hazard Monitoring.- Chapter 2: Overview of The Holistic Approach and Book Structure.- Part 2: Multicriteria Decision Making Models.- Chapter 3: Multi-Criteria Decision-Making Framework For Identifying Multi-Hazard Risk Hotspots In Coastal Plains of South India.- Chapter 4: Flood Susceptibility Mapping In The Kaljani River Basin: Insights From AHP-PROMETHEE II and AHP Methods.- Chapter 5: Assessment of Landslide Susceptibility Along NH27 and NH627 In Assam, India Using GIS Based Multi Criteria Decision Making and Analytical Hierarchy Process.- Chapter 6: Assessment of Groundwater Potential Zone After Rohingya Rehabilitation Using GIS and Analytic Hierarchy Process (AHP) Techniques In Ukhia Sub-District, Cox’s Bazar.- Chapter 7: GIS-Integrated Landslide Susceptibility Mapping In Teesta River Basin of Darjeeling-Sikkim Himalaya: A Comparative Analysis of Frequency Ratio, Logistic Regression Models, and Analytical Hierarchy Process.- Chapter 8: Spatial Assessment of Urban Resilience In The City District of Lahore Using GIS and Multicriteria Decision-Making Tools.- Chapter 9: Integrated Geomorphological and Hydrological Analysis for Flood Hazard Assessment in the Ngawun River Basin, Ayeyarwady Region, Myanmar.- Chapter 10: Flash Flood Susceptibility and Inundation Mapping Using Shannon's Entropy, Statistical Index, and HEC-RAS.- Part 3: Integrated Multicriteria Decision Making Models.- Chapter 11: An Application of MARCOS, CoCoSo, and GRA MCDM Models In A Hybrid Approach For Landslide Susceptibility Assessment In Wayanad District, Kerala (India).- Chapter 12: Utilizing Multicriteria Decision-Making Techniques For Computing Composite Vulnerability Over A Severely Flood-Prone Multi-Hazard Catchment.- Chapter 13: Flood Susceptibility Modelling of Tripura, India: An Application of Preference Selection Index (PSI) and Geospatial Technology.- Chapter 14: Socio-economic-cum-Physical Vulnerabilities To Riverine Floods Over Large Watersheds: A Comprehensive Framework By Leveraging Shannon Entropy and TOPSIS.- Chapter 15: Enhanced Landslide Susceptibility Assessment along Transport Infrastructures Through Hybrid Ensembled Learning Techniques.- Chapter 16: Advanced Optimization Techniques for Parameter Calibration In The DRASTIC Model: A Multi-Criteria Decision Analysis Approach To Groundwater Vulnerability Assessment.- Chapter 17: A Hybrid Novel Ensemble of Prediction Indices For GIS-Based Flood Susceptibility Zonation.- Chapter 18: GIS-Based Multi-Hazard Risk Analysis and Disaster Risk Reduction Planning Using Coupled Multi-Hazard Assessment Method.- Chapter 19: Hybrid Ensemble Approaches To Landslide Susceptibility Mapping: Fusing Advanced Multi-Criteria-Decision-Making With Machine Learning In Darjeeling Himalayas.- Part 4: Conclusion.- Chapter 20: Shifting Paradigms: The Rise of Multi-Criteria-Decision-Making Models Over Bivariate Statistical Approaches In Hazard Risk Assessment.- Chapter 21: Advancements In Multi-Criteria Decision-Making Models: A New Paradigm for Monitoring Flood Risks In Algeria.-Chapter 22: Usage and Future Path of MCDM For Hazard Monitoring and Risk Assessment.
